2025年手机游戏测试工程师招聘面试参考试题及答案.docxVIP

2025年手机游戏测试工程师招聘面试参考试题及答案.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

2025年手机游戏测试工程师招聘面试参考试题及答案

一、自我认知与职业动机

1.你认为作为一名手机游戏测试工程师,最重要的素质是什么?为什么?

作为一名手机游戏测试工程师,我认为最重要的素质是细致入微的观察力和高度的责任心。游戏测试工作的核心在于发现潜在的问题和缺陷,这要求测试人员必须具备极强的观察力,能够深入游戏场景的每一个角落,捕捉到普通玩家可能忽略的细节。无论是界面显示的微小瑕疵、特定操作下的逻辑异常,还是边界条件下的性能波动,都需要通过敏锐的观察力来发现。责任心是确保测试质量的关键。测试工程师是对游戏产品质量负有直接责任的一员,任何被遗漏的缺陷都可能导致玩家体验下降甚至游戏失败。因此,强烈的责任心会驱动我积极主动地投入工作,不放过任何一个可能影响产品质量的问题点,尽职尽责地完成测试任务,确保交付给玩家的游戏产品尽可能完美。这种细致与责任感的结合,是保证测试工作有效性的基石。

2.在你过往的经历中,有没有遇到过特别困难的技术问题或挑战?你是如何解决的?

在我之前参与的一个项目测试中,遇到了一个较为棘手的技术问题。该款游戏在特定网络环境下会出现频繁的掉线现象,但复现路径非常隐蔽且不稳定,仅凭常规的测试流程难以捕捉。面对这个挑战,我首先对问题发生的具体环境进行了详细的分析,包括网络类型、延迟、丢包率等数据。接着,我主动学习了相关的网络通信知识和游戏客户端的网络模块代码逻辑,尝试理解掉线发生的可能原因。随后,我设计了一系列更加精细化的测试用例,模拟各种极端网络条件,并利用抓包工具对网络数据进行深度分析。通过反复的测试和数据分析,最终定位到是游戏在处理网络重连机制时存在一个边界条件逻辑错误。为了验证这一点,我编写了一个小的调试工具来强制触发该边界条件,成功复现了问题。最终与开发团队协作,通过修改代码逻辑解决了该问题。这个过程不仅锻炼了我的问题分析和解决能力,也让我深刻体会到深入理解产品技术和主动运用工具进行排查的重要性。

3.你为什么选择成为手机游戏测试工程师?这个职业最吸引你的地方是什么?

我选择成为手机游戏测试工程师,主要基于以下几点原因。我对游戏行业本身怀有浓厚的兴趣和热情。手机游戏作为一种便捷且内容丰富的娱乐方式,其用户体验至关重要。我希望能够参与到这样一个充满创造力和活力的行业中,通过自己的工作来保障和提升游戏的质量,让玩家能够获得更好的娱乐体验。测试工程师这个职业让我感觉能够扮演一个独特而重要的角色。在产品开发的整个生命周期中,测试是连接开发与玩家的关键桥梁,是确保产品质量的最后一道防线。我发现这个过程充满了挑战性,需要不断学习新知识、掌握新工具,并在看似枯燥的重复测试中发现不寻常的问题,这种“侦探式”的工作内容深深吸引了我。最吸引我的地方在于,我的工作能够直接对产品的最终呈现产生积极影响,每一个发现并推动解决的问题,都能让游戏变得更好,这种通过自己的努力提升产品价值并获得认可的感觉,是极具成就感的。

4.你认为游戏测试工程师的工作与游戏开发工程师的工作有什么不同?你更倾向于哪一个?

游戏测试工程师和游戏开发工程师的工作确实存在显著的不同。开发工程师主要负责根据设计文档和需求规格,利用编程语言和工具进行游戏功能、玩法、美术、特效等的实现和开发,他们更侧重于“创造”和“构建”游戏世界。而测试工程师则是在游戏开发完成后,从用户的角度出发,对产品的功能、性能、兼容性、易用性等方面进行全面的质量检查和评估,侧重于“发现”和“优化”潜在的问题,确保产品达到预期的质量标准。我认为这两类工作都非常重要,是相辅相成的。开发工程师构建了游戏的基础骨架,而测试工程师则负责检查和完善这个骨架,确保它足够坚固和耐用。我个人更倾向于游戏测试工程师这个角色。虽然开发工作富有创造力,但我更享受在既定框架内通过细致的观察和严谨的测试来发现问题、推动改进的过程。测试工作让我能够深入了解产品的方方面面,并在与开发团队的沟通协作中不断学习和成长,这种以保障产品质量为核心价值的工作方式,更符合我的职业兴趣和性格特点。

5.你如何理解“测试左移”和“测试右移”的概念?你认为在手机游戏开发中应该如何实践?

“测试左移”是指将测试活动尽可能地向软件开发生命周期的早期阶段移动,即在需求分析、设计阶段就开始介入,提前预防缺陷的产生。它强调的是在开发开始之前就考虑质量,通过评审需求、设计文档,编写可测试的需求规格等方式,从源头上减少问题的发生。“测试右移”则是指将部分测试活动(尤其是非功能测试和验收测试)向开发周期的后期甚至交付前移动,利用自动化测试、持续集成/持续交付(CI/CD)等手段,在接近最终交付时进行更全面和高效的验证。在手机游戏开发中实践这两个概念,我认为应该这样进行。在项目初期,测试团队可以积极参与需求评审和设计评审,从测试角度提出建议,确保需

文档评论(0)

187****3820 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档